Modern Action Briefing
Rep. Matt Van Epps introduced a resolution to commemorate the fifth anniversary of the Abbey Gate bombing in Kabul, Afghanistan, while criticizing the Biden-Harris administration's handling of the situation.
- The Abbey Gate bombing occurred five years ago in Kabul, resulting in multiple casualties.
- Rep. Matt Van Epps, a former Army aviator, is advocating for recognition of the anniversary through a resolution.
- The lawmaker's message included significant criticism of the current administration.
Why it matters
The resolution and accompanying message highlight ongoing concerns regarding U.S. foreign policy and military operations.
